Oxford Earthenware Redware Bee Skep Charger by Tomashausky, 1997 - A contemporary redware earthenware charger featuring a high-gloss, reddish-brown slip-glazed surface. The central motif depicts a hand-painted beehive skep in textured shades of cream and tan, complete with a dark arched entrance. The base of the skep is decorated with a textured green and white glaze suggestive of grass. Four stylized bees are shown in flight around the hive. The shallow, slightly upturned rim is finished with a mottled dark brown border. The unglazed reverse shows the natural red clay body and bears an incised signature Tomashausky followed by a copyright symbol and the date 1997. It also features a circular stamp with a central R surrounded by Oxford Earthenware and a smaller circular Lead Free stamp. Diameter: 10.5 inches.
